Wedding Season
For more cost-effective weddings, try choosing a date that is atypical to wedding season. The wedding season is traditionally from May through September. These are the times when wedding venues are most expensive. If you must book then, try booking well ahead of time to get a great deal.

When planning a wedding, alcohol needs to be a consideration as to what type you want to serve, as well as what the costs are going to be. Open bars are typically very expensive, especially when they are open for long time-periods. Ask the venue about their various alcohol service options.
The lighting at the wedding reception venue should be able to be dimmed. This may seem like a minor factor, but many couples like dimming the lights for a first dance, and switching to brighter lights for the remainder of the event. Before committing to a venue, you will want to ask about this option.
